Vegetable Biryani Easy and Layered - How to make?
This recipe involves cooking the rice and vegetables with gravy separately, then layering them in a serving dish, and finally gently mixing them.
To Make the Vegetable Gravy
Steps 1-2) In a pan, add a combination of ghee and oil, diced onions, and sautée. Add ginger-garlic paste, slit green chilies, and sautée again.

Step 3)Next, add the biryani masala, coriander powder, garam masala (how to make your own garam masala), and salt to taste.
Step 4 -5) Add vegetables, mix well, and cook covered till it is done. Add chopped coriander and mint leaves and mix well.

To Make the Rice
Step 6) Heat the ghee and oil mentioned in the ingredients section in an Instant Pot. Add cloves, cardamom, cinnamon, star anise, and bay leaves. Step 7)Next, add onions and green chilies and sautee well.
Step 8) Add the soaked and washed rice, and fry for about 10 minutes till the rice is opaque. Step 9) Add salt and 3 cups of water, and set to cook with the "rice" option. Step 10) Fluff the rice.

Step 11 -12) In a casserole or serving dish, layer the rice, followed by the vegetable gravy. Add another layer of rice, vegetable gravy, and repeat. Gently mix well.

Squeeze some lemon juice and garnish with chopped coriander and mint leaves. You can also garnish with fried onions if you like. Serve with yogurt, salad, pickle, and papad (fritters).
Useful Tips
- You can add any vegetable to this dish. I have mainly used carrots, beans, potatoes, and peas. You can also add paneer and soya chunks if you like.
- Use Frozen veggies if you do not have fresh veggies or are in a short of time.
- Wash and soak the rice for about 10 minutes before cooking so it cooks thoroughly.
- You can also choose to garnish with fried onions, nuts, and raisins if you like.

Recipe FAQs
The best option is to use Basmati rice for the perfect texture and layering.
For the first cup of rice, use double the amount of water. For every other cup of rice that is used, use a cup of water thereafter. It also sometimes depends on the brand of the rice. Soaking the rice before frying and cooking also helps give a fluffy texture.

Vegetable Biryani Easy
Ingredients
- 2 cups Rice Basmati
- 4 tsp Clarified Butter ghee
- 4 tsp oil
- 3-4 cloves
- ½ inch cinnamon
- 1 star-anise
- 5--6 cardamoms
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 onion diced
- 1 tsp salt
- 3 cups Water
- 2 cups vegetables diced (potatoes, carrot, beans,peas)
- 1 tsp ginger garlic paste
- 4 green chillies
- 1 tsp Biryani masala (optional)
- 2 tsp Coriander powder
- 1 tsp Garam masala
- ½ bunch coriander leaves chopped
- ½ bunch mint leaves chopped
- 1 lemon
Instructions
To Make Gravy
- In a pan, add ghee and oil, diced onions, and sautée it.
- Add ginger-garlic paste, slit green chillies, and sautée again.
- Add the biryani masala, coriander powder, garam masala, and salt to taste
- Add vegetables, mix well and cook covered till it is done.
- Add chopped coriander and mint leaves and mix well.
To Make Rice
- Wash the rice, drain, and keep aside.
- Switch on the "saute" mode in the Instant Pot. Add Ghee when hot.
- Add cloves, cardamom, cinnamon, star anise, and bay leaves.
- Next, add the washed and drained rice, and fry for about 10 minutes until the rice is opaque.
- Add salt and 3 cups of water, and cook with the "rice" option.
Layering the Rice and Vegetable Gravy
- Layer the rice and vegetable gravy in a serving dish with one layer of rice followed by the vegetable gravy, and repeat.
- Gently mix well.
- Squeeze some lemon juice and garnish with chopped coriander leaves.
- You can also garnish with fried onions, cashews, and raisins if you like.
- Serve with yogurt, salad, pickle, and papad (fritters).
